summaryrefslogtreecommitdiff
path: root/ubi-utils/Makefile
diff options
context:
space:
mode:
authorArtem Bityutskiy <Artem.Bityutskiy@nokia.com>2009-04-26 09:01:12 +0300
committerArtem Bityutskiy <Artem.Bityutskiy@nokia.com>2009-05-11 12:05:50 +0300
commit32252f2b902d88f2991d260f2982b10b2016c33b (patch)
tree3081ae785d80c563837815a5b053747f0c9d1f34 /ubi-utils/Makefile
parente7454c3c3928ee7af7e76c0521f477881c9bf60f (diff)
ubi-utils: add sysfs interface support and new tool
This large commit makes several things. 1. Switches libmtd to use the new sysfs interface 2. Implements new handy 'mtdinfo' utility 3. Does minore amendmends in libubi and some ubi-tools. Signed-off-by: Artem Bityutskiy <Artem.Bityutskiy@nokia.com>
Diffstat (limited to 'ubi-utils/Makefile')
-rw-r--r--ubi-utils/Makefile10
1 files changed, 7 insertions, 3 deletions
diff --git a/ubi-utils/Makefile b/ubi-utils/Makefile
index dcff7e3..b5388ec 100644
--- a/ubi-utils/Makefile
+++ b/ubi-utils/Makefile
@@ -6,12 +6,12 @@ KERNELHDR := ../include
SUBDIRS = old-utils
-#CFLAGS += -Werror
+# CFLAGS += -Werror
CPPFLAGS += -Iinclude -Isrc -I$(KERNELHDR)
LIBS = libubi libmtd libubigen libiniparser libscan
TARGETS = ubiupdatevol ubimkvol ubirmvol ubicrc32 ubinfo ubiattach \
- ubidetach ubinize ubiformat ubirename
+ ubidetach ubinize ubiformat ubirename mtdinfo
VPATH = src
@@ -30,13 +30,17 @@ $(BUILDDIR)/ubinize: $(addprefix $(BUILDDIR)/,\
ubinize.o common.o crc32.o libiniparser.a libubigen.a)
# $(CC) $(CFLAGS) $(filter %.o, $^) -L. -liniparser -lubigen -o $@
+$(BUILDDIR)/mtdinfo: $(addprefix $(BUILDDIR)/,\
+ libmtd.a libubigen.a crc32.o common.o)
+# $(CC) $(CFLAGS) $(filter %.o, $^) -L. -lmtd -lubigen -o $@
+
$(BUILDDIR)/ubiformat: $(addprefix $(BUILDDIR)/,\
ubiformat.o common.o crc32.o libmtd.a libscan.a libubi.a libubigen.a)
# $(CC) $(CFLAGS) $(filter %.o, $^) -L. -lmtd -lscan -lubi -lubigen -o $@
$(BUILDDIR)/libubi.a: $(BUILDDIR)/libubi.o
-$(BUILDDIR)/libmtd.a: $(BUILDDIR)/libmtd.o
+$(BUILDDIR)/libmtd.a: $(BUILDDIR)/libmtd.o $(BUILDDIR)/libmtd_legacy.o
$(BUILDDIR)/libubigen.a: $(BUILDDIR)/libubigen.o